About us
Old Mutual Limited is a premium pan-African financial services group that offers a broad spectrum of financial solutions to retail and corporate customers across key markets in 14 countries. We have been helping our customers achieve their lifetime financial goals for over 170 years by investing their funds in ways that create positive futures for them, their families, their communities and broader society. In this way, we significantly contribute to improving the lives of our customers and their communities while ensuring a sustainable future for our business. We employ more than 30 000 people and operate in 14 countries across two regions Africa (South Africa, Namibia, Botswana, Zimbabwe, Kenya, Malawi, Tanzania, Nigeria, Ghana, Uganda, Rwanda, South Sudan and eSwatini) as well as Asia (China) So why work here? There’s a cause-and-effect relationship between your organisation’s employee benefits, their financial wellness, and job satisfaction. Benefits that help employees to become financially secure and support their overall wellbeing make them more likely to be happy at work, more productive, and more invested in the business. And to achieve that, organisations need integrated employee benefits that meet their workforce’s needs in a number of different ways.
